92faf7c082 Add standalone core library with kimath and sexpr (Phase 2 Step 1)
Create standalone build system for KiCad's core computation libraries
that compiles without wxWidgets, targeting both native and WebAssembly.

Key additions:
- wx_shim.h: ~250 lines replacing wx utilities with standard C++
  - wxString class with Format() method
  - wxFFile for file I/O
  - wxASSERT, wxCHECK, wxFAIL_MSG macros
  - wxLog stubs
- Stub headers: wx/debug.h, wx/log.h, wx/string.h, wx/file.h, etc.
- config.h, advanced_config.h: Platform and triangulation config
- CMakeLists.txt: Builds kimath, sexpr, clipper2, rtree

Build results:
- Native: libkimath.a (1.4MB), libsexpr.a, test passes
- WASM: test_kimath.wasm (867KB), runs in Node.js

Test verifies:
- VECTOR2I, SEG, SHAPE_POLY_SET geometry operations
- S-expression parsing of .kicad_pcb format

f1526d8c24 Complete Phase 1: Build KiCad with optional dependencies disabled
Add CMake override modules, stub implementations, and patches to build
KiCad without CURL, libgit2, OpenCASCADE, and ngspice dependencies.

- cmake/: Find modules that provide stub targets when deps disabled
- stubs/include/: Header stubs for curl, git2, ngspice, OCC
- stubs/src/: Implementation stubs for disabled features
- patches/: Consolidated patch for KiCad source modifications
- scripts/: Build helper scripts

Verified full native build on macOS with all optional deps disabled.
